Um...whatever.
I didn't spend $40K for my 2000 9.5. It was around $23K (used) with 20,000 miles on the clock. Personally, I consider it a bargain (especially with the extended warranty).
Most of us expect that it will cost more to maintain a Saab than, say, a Hyundai. However, most of us would rather walk than drive a Hyundai, so it's money well-spent. ;-)
What we often object to is the extremely high cost of *dealer* service, particularly since many dealers do not deliver the high level of *customer service* that should accompany such prices. Given the relatively few Saab dealers in some parts of the country, many of us have little choice as to where we obtain dealer service, and may vent our frustration here.
Incidentally, I've endured some pretty hefty bills at my local Honda dealer for repairs to my wife's '97 Accord (out of warranty), so don't assume that all Japanese automobiles are a runaway bargain when it comes to service costs.
